where can you park?
Address: 104 McWhorter St, Newark, NJ 07105, USA
Matt Sweetwood | Oct 1, 2019
On the street and good luck 🤞
Fred Kapmeyer | Oct 1, 2019
Street Parking
Richard Cooper | Oct 1, 2019
Street parking only.
Alycia Graham | Oct 1, 2019
On the street
Thanks! Your answer is awaiting moderation.